The Setup: A Tight Game Until the 9th

Going into the bottom of the ninth, the game was a tense affair. The score was a close 3-2 in favor of the Padres, a testament to a fiercely contested game. The Angels had battled hard, but the Padres' pitching staff had largely kept them at bay throughout the previous eight innings. It was a close contest, filled with key moments that kept both fan bases on the edge of their seats. The Padres' starting pitcher delivered a solid performance, keeping the Angels' offense in check for most of the game. The Angels' bats struggled to find their rhythm against the Padres' formidable pitching, leading to a frustrating game for Angels fans until the final inning.

  • Score after 8 innings: Padres 3 - Angels 2
  • Key plays/moments: A crucial double play in the 6th inning snuffed out an Angels rally. A solo home run by the Padres in the 7th extended their lead.
  • Starting pitchers' performances: Both starting pitchers pitched well, showcasing excellent command and keeping the game low-scoring until the dramatic ninth.

The Grand Slam: Ward's Heroic Moment

With the bases loaded and two outs in the bottom of the ninth, Taylor Ward stepped up to the plate. The tension in the stadium was palpable. The count went to 2-2, the crowd holding its breath. Then, a fastball – a perfectly placed offering from the Padres' closer – that Ward crushed. The ball soared high into the night sky, a majestic arc that seemed to hang in the air forever before clearing the fence. A walk-off grand slam! The stadium erupted in a cacophony of cheers and joyous screams. The Angels dugout emptied onto the field, engulfing Ward in a celebratory pile. This game-winning grand slam was truly a heroic moment, a testament to Ward's incredible power and composure under immense pressure.

  • Pitch count before the grand slam: 2-2
  • Type of pitch thrown: Fastball
  • Distance and trajectory of the home run: Estimated at 420 feet, a towering shot to right field.
  • Ward's post-game interview quotes: "It felt amazing. It's a moment I'll never forget. I just tried to stay calm and put a good swing on it."
